Remove-ServiceFabricApplication

Rimuove un'applicazione di Service Fabric.

Sintassi

Remove-ServiceFabricApplication
      [-ApplicationName] <Uri>
      [-Force]
      [-ForceRemove]
      [-TimeoutSec <Int32>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Descrizione

Il cmdlet Remove-ServiceFabricApplication rimuove un'applicazione da Service Fabric.

Prima di eseguire qualsiasi operazione in un cluster di Service Fabric, stabilire una connessione al cluster usando il cmdlet Connect-ServiceFabricCluster .

Esempio

Esempio 1: Rimuovere un'applicazione

PS C:\> Remove-ServiceFabricApplication -ApplicationName fabric:/myapp/persistenttodolist -Force

Questo comando rimuove l'applicazione con l'URI specificato. Poiché questo comando include il parametro Force , il cmdlet non richiede la conferma prima di rimuovere l'applicazione.

Parametri

-ApplicationName

Specifica l'URI (Uniform Resource Identifier) di un'applicazione di Service Fabric. Per ottenere i nomi (URI) delle applicazioni attualmente distribuite, usare Get-ServiceFabricApplication. Il cmdlet rimuove l'applicazione con l'URI specificato.

Type:Uri
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-Confirm

Richiede la conferma dell'utente prima di eseguire il c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Force

Forza l'esecuzione del comando senza chiedere conferma all'utente.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ForceRemove

Indica che questo cmdlet forza la rimozione dell'applicazione. Questa operazione deve essere usata solo se la rimozione dell'applicazione è in timeout. È effettivamente uguale al passaggio di -ForceRemove a ogni chiamata di servizio di rimozione interna. Per altre informazioni sulla rimozione dei servizi, vedere Il cmdlet ForceRemoveRemove-ServiceFabricService .

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-TimeoutSec

Specifica il periodo di timeout, in secondi, per l'operazione. Se l'operazione è scaduta, lo stato dell'applicazione non è indeterminato. Usare Get-ServiceFabricApplicationHealth per determinare lo stato dell'applicazione o usare il parametro ForceRemove per rimuovere forzatamente l'applicazione.

Type:Int32
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Mostra l'esito in caso di esecuzione del cmdlet. Il cmdlet non viene eseguito e non vengono apportate modifiche permanenti.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Input

System.Uri

Output

System.Object